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000326765.10(APOLD1):​c.96+540T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.502 in 151,930 control chromosomes in the GnomAD database, including 19,457 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

APOLD1 (HGNC:25268): (apolipoprotein L domain containing 1) APOLD1 is an endothelial cell early response protein that may play a role in regulation of endothelial cell signaling and vascular function (Regard et al., 2004 [PubMed 15102925]).[supplied by OMIM, Dec 2008]
